A Novel Mobile 3D Printing Robot Incorporating a Planar Five-bar Mechanism

Abstract:

With the continuous development of additive manufacturing technology, an increasing number of fields integrated with 3D printing, providing new opportunities for its advancement. In this paper, a novel mobile 3D printing robot was proposed that cooperated a planar five-bar mechanism to overcome limitations of traditional 3D printers, such as immobility and restricted working range. The mobile 3D printing robot had a unique working mode that utilizes a planar five-bar mechanism to follow the trajectory of a planar model. The robot controls a linear model to achieve the lifting of the ejector, enabling the completion of the manufacturing process. Furthermore, when paired with a mobile platform, the robot had the ability to extend infinitely on the x and y axes. Trajectory simulations and work demonstrations were conducted on the robot, showcasing its ability to achieve complex trajectories and manufacture large-scale models.
